Multi-Functional Manufacturing Supervisor - Level 3

internshipPosted: Dec 7, 2025

Job Description


Description:What You Will Be Doing
The supervisor will be responsible for planning daily activities, sequencing, assigning work to support desired goals and targets across multiple COE Assembly Work Areas. Candidate must have exceptional people-skills and cultivate program performance on all aspects of quality, cost, and schedule.
• Lead a team of approximately 20 employees with a focus on rate assembly operations.
• Responsible for motivating improvement, corrective actions, identifying risk mitigation actions, and solving complex problems across multiple programs such as F-35, F-16, F-22, etc.
• Embrace Full Spectrum Leadership qualities to develop supports and empower teams to encourage ownership throughout the organization.

Must be a US Citizen. This position is located at a facility that requires special access.

Basic Qualifications:
Experience with tools and processes involving drilling, grinding, fastening and sanding as well as other machines and systems typically used in a production/manufacturing environment.

- Managing business metrics to drive performance (Quality, Schedule, and Cost).

- Working knowledge of crew planning, line balancing, and project management.

- Experience with Microsoft Office programs (i.e. Word, Excel, Power Point, and Power BI)
Desired Skills:
- Previous leadership experience

- Experience in manufacturing/productions methodologies relating to structural and mechanical assemblies.

- Excellent communication skills.

- Experience with Solumina, MTO, and/or SAP systems.

- Experience with Lean Manufacturing concepts and application.

- Degree from an accredited college, or equivalent experience/combined education.
